amazon.co.uk
Amazon.co.uk is an online retail platform offering a vast range of consumer goods. It provides access to a diversified collection of products including books, electronics, clothing, home essentials, beauty products, and more. The website offers a convenient shopping experience and is a popular destination in the United Kingdom for online purchasing.

amazon.co.uk competitors
In May 2025, amazon.co.uk generated a revenue of £1,454,743,710 from 14,971,961 transactions with 350,615,388 sessions. The average order value (AOV) ranged between £75-£100, and the conversion rate was between 4.00% to 4.50%. When compared to its competitors, amazon.com outperformed in terms of revenue with £12,259,837,505, from 178,880,882 transactions and 2,589,786,292 sessions. etsy.com had a revenue of £523,097,263 with 7,888,523 transactions and 405,156,580 sessions. ebay.co.uk recorded a revenue of £620,742,252 from 8,258,607 transactions and 192,068,873 sessions, while argos.co.uk and johnlewis.com had lower revenues and transaction numbers. Despite strong competition, amazon.co.uk remained competitive in AOV and conversion rate, similar to ebay.co.uk, showcasing its strength in attracting and converting customers.
Revenue share by device at amazon.co.uk
In May large majority of sales on amazon.co.uk, 75% was finalized on desktop devices, with 25% of sales coming from mobile devices.
